How Long Do Hookups Usually Last? Unpacking the Timeline of Casual Encounters
When it comes to casual encounters, often referred to as "hookups," there's no single, definitive answer to the question of "how long do hookups usually last." The duration of a hookup is incredibly fluid and depends on a multitude of factors, ranging from the individuals involved and their expectations to the specific circumstances and even the geographical location. Unlike committed relationships with established timelines, hookups are typically defined by their spontaneity and lack of long-term commitment, making their duration inherently variable.
Understanding the Spectrum of Hookup Durations
To provide a more detailed answer, it's helpful to break down the potential timelines for hookups into general categories. It's important to remember that these are broad estimations and individual experiences will always vary.
The "Quickie" Hookup
In some instances, a hookup can be incredibly brief, sometimes lasting as little as an hour or even less. This might occur when:
- Two people meet at a bar or party and decide to go home together for a short, physical encounter.
- The primary motivation is immediate sexual gratification, with no expectation of further interaction.
- Logistical constraints are a factor, such as one or both individuals having early morning commitments.
These encounters are often characterized by their efficiency and straightforwardness. There's usually no preamble beyond initial attraction and mutual consent, and the focus is solely on the sexual act.
The "Standard" Hookup
A more common scenario for a hookup might involve a duration of a few hours to a full evening or night. This typically includes:
- Time spent getting to know each other a little, perhaps over drinks or while traveling to a private location.
- Foreplay and sexual activity.
- Potentially some post-coital cuddling or conversation before parting ways.
This type of hookup allows for a more relaxed and potentially more satisfying experience, without delving into the complexities of a relationship. It provides an opportunity for mutual pleasure and a shared experience that ends with a clear understanding of its casual nature.
The "Overnighter" Hookup
Sometimes, a hookup can extend into an "overnighter," meaning it lasts through the night and into the morning. This doesn't necessarily imply a deep emotional connection, but rather:
- A comfortable and enjoyable experience that leads to staying the night.
- The convenience of not having to travel home late.
- A shared morning-after experience, which could involve a quick breakfast or just parting ways after waking up.
Even in an overnighter, the crucial element remains the absence of commitment or expectation of a future relationship. It's still fundamentally a casual arrangement.
Factors Influencing Hookup Duration
Several key factors can significantly influence how long a hookup ultimately lasts:
- Mutual Attraction and Chemistry: Strong chemistry can lead to a longer, more engaging encounter, even within the confines of a casual arrangement.
- Individual Expectations: This is perhaps the most critical factor. If both individuals are on the same page about wanting a quick physical release versus a more extended, intimate experience, the duration will align with those expectations. Misaligned expectations can lead to discomfort or premature endings.
- Comfort Level: The more comfortable individuals feel with each other, the more likely they are to relax and let the encounter unfold naturally, potentially extending its duration.
- Logistics and Time Constraints: As mentioned, early morning commitments, travel distances, or needing to be somewhere else can all dictate a shorter timeline.
- Alcohol or Substance Influence: While sometimes a catalyst for hookups, excessive consumption can also lead to impaired judgment, potentially affecting the duration or the overall experience.
- Communication: Open and honest communication, even in a casual context, can help set expectations and ensure both parties are comfortable with the progression and duration of the encounter.

The "Aftermath" of a Hookup
The duration of the physical encounter is only one part of the hookup experience. What happens afterward can also vary widely:
- No Contact: This is very common. Both individuals go their separate ways with no expectation of further communication.
- Friendly Text Exchange: A polite text the next day to say "had fun" or "hope you got home okay" is also relatively common and doesn't necessarily signal a desire for more.
- "Friends with Benefits" Transition: In rarer cases, a hookup can evolve into a more regular arrangement of friends with benefits, where casual sex becomes a recurring part of a platonic friendship. This is a significant shift from a one-time hookup.
